Zambia demands Russia to explain how its citizen ended up on the battlefield in Ukraine

Zambia urges Russia to explain how its citizen from the Moscow prison ended up on the battlefield and was killed in Ukraine.

Zambia has asked Russia to explain how one of its citizen - a student, who had been serving a prison sentence in Moscow, ended up on the battlefield in Ukraine and was killed there. This was sated by Zambia’s Foreign Minister Stanley Kakubo, as reported by Reuters.

A week ago, on November 5, The Insider reported that over 500 prisoners recruited by Prigozhin to Wagner's PMK had been killed in Ukraine in two months.

By the way, today Vladimir Putin signed a decree legalizing the conscription of persons with second citizenship into the Russian army. The decree also allows foreign citizens to serve as officers in the Russian army under contract.
